Training Objectives
Those participating in this Training Analyst training course will be able to:
- Apply the principles of andragogy to the training cycle (application)
- Differentiate between succession planning and talent management (analysis)
- Design a course outline utilising Blooms taxonomy for educational objectives (synthesis)
- Defend training decisions based on cost-benefit analysis (evaluation)
- Describe the training cycle and its application in the modern training and development department (knowledge)
- Discuss the limitations and advantages of a learning styles approach to training (comprehension)

Training Outline
DAY 1: The Training Cycle and Training Needs Analysis (TNA)
- The need for training to produce measurable results
- The Training Cycle (Analysis, Design, Develop, Conduct, Evaluate)
- Aligning training and development to meet business objectives
- Conducting a training needs analysis (TNA)
- Identifying and meeting learning needs
DAY 2: How People Learn and Barriers to Learning
- Re-engineering the learning experience – Andragogy Explored
- How to measure learning styles and the limitations
- The use of aptitude testing and personality testing
- The limitations of testing personality
- Overcoming learning problems
DAY 3: The Use of Learning Objectives, Design & Development
- Understanding knowledge, skills & attitude (KSA)
- What are learning outcome objectives and why do we need them?
- Writing objectives using Bloom’s Taxonomy
- Internal vs. External training provision
- Design and development essentials for all learning activities
DAY 4: Evaluating Training
- The rationale for the evidence-based approach
- State-of-the-art analytics: Stages on the journey
- Understanding the use of metrics in training
- Kirkpatrick's levels of evaluation
- Calculating a cost-benefit and the return on investment (ROI)
DAY 5: Critical Issues in Training, Learning, & Development
- Should training functions be profit centres?
- Differentiating succession planning & talent management
- Understanding the learning needs of New Generations (Gen Y & Z)
- Understanding coaching and mentoring
- Personal action planning
